Just found this in another thread... most of the DR201s I am seeing on the net are the 4 KT88 versions. Mine is the six EL34 version...

"""most Hiwatt bass amps, i.e. DR201 and DR405, have KT88 power tubes, not EL34. Some vintage DR201s have six EL34 tubes but these are rarer than the KT88 version."""

Nice amp. Hiwatt and other manufacturers cut back on using KT88s starting around 1977 due to a shortage after the demise of GEC. Most or all of the late 70s DR201 amps are 6xEL34.

Can you show any gut shots of the amp? It looks like someone added an adjustable bias pot and extra jack.

I have three vintage Hiwatt amps: 400w DR405 and two 100w DR103s. They are truly excellent. Hope you enjoy the DR201.

Quote:
Originally Posted by beebassdude
if you dont mind posting (or PMing me) how much did you pay? theres one at a local shop and the guy wants $3800 (which i think is insane) but im just wondering what kinda deal you got. thanks dude!
Too high.

The highest I've ever seen a DR201 sell from eBay bidding was about $3,300 14 months ago. That 1972 DR201 was near mint condition with all of the original Mullard Blackburn pre-amp tubes and GEC KT88 power tubes.

Most DR201s sell for about $1500 to $2500 depending on condition, location, who's looking to buy at the time, etc.
